The Five Points Theater Building, constructed in 1927 by architect Roy Benjamin, is located in Jacksonville’s Historic 5 Points District. Originally built to house the Riverside Theater, it was the first theater in Florida and the third in the nation to show talking pictures. The building was designed for potential reconversion back into a theater. Today, this mixed-use building provides space for retailers and office users. Office space is available on the 2nd, 3rd, and 4th floors.
